CAPPADOCIA. Hierapolis (Comana). Hadrian, 117-138. Drachm (Silver, 18 mm, 3.11 g, 12 h), 128-138. ΑΔΡΙΑΝΟϹ ϹЄΒΑϹΤΟϹ Laureate head of Hadrian to right. Rev. ΥΠΑΤΟϹ Γ ΠΑΤΗ[Ρ ΠΑ]ΤΡΙ Tyche seated left, holding rudder in her right hand and cornucopiae in her left. Ganschow 191a. RPC III online 3169.4 (this coin). Sydenham, Caesarea, 278a. Very rare. Die break on the obverse and the reverse slightly brushed, otherwise, very fine.

From the collection of Eric ten Brink, ex Naumann E-Auction 45, 3 July 2016, 583.
